Assassin's Creed Movie in 2013?

 

hp-topslot_AC3-cgi-trailertcm2153795.jpg

 

The Assassin's Creed movie starring Michael Fassbender could be out as early as next year.

 

Speaking to GamesIndustry.biz about the future of the franchise beyond the release of ACIII, Ubisoft's chief sales and marketing officer Geoffroy Sardin said:

 

“Another thing that is very important for the lifecycle is the transmedia offer. All the figurines, the books, the publishing, and we have a movie in the next coming year. So it's not only about games, we are talking about a global brand, and this is the life cycle management we want to set up now.”

 

Now this could mean a few things. He could, of course, be referring to the production of the film, which has been fast-tracked, not its actual release date. It could also refer to the next financial year 2013/14, with the film coming out in 2014. But either way, it sounds like the production of the movie is on track and we'll see it very soon.

it does not matter if your account is indian/Eu or Us!

 

you can play a game from any region.only thing is the dlc used (including online pass) must be redeemed in the same region account as your disc.

 

eg. if your primary account is a US account,redeem the code in a Indian/uk account (on the same ps3) and then resume playing with your primary US iD.
